Clinical Significance
CEA with HAMA Treatment - CEA is a tumor marker that is useful to monitor patients with persistent, recurrent or metastatic colonic carcinoma. Patients who have received mouse monoclonal antibodies as part of treatment should have their specimens pre-treated for removal of the human antimouse antibodies (HAMA).

Test Details
Methodology
Immunoassay (IA)
Reference Range(s)
| CEA, HAMA Treated | See below |
| CEA, Untreated | |
| Non-smoker | <2.5 ng/mL |
| Smoker | <5.0 ng/mL |
Preferred Specimen(s)
2 mL serum
Minimum Volume
1 mL
Transport Container
Transport tube
Transport Temperature
Room temperature
Specimen Stability
- Room temperature: 7 days
- Refrigerated: 7 days
- Frozen: 28 days
